Iceland - Density of Computed Tomography Scanners in Ambulatory Sector
Since 2014, Iceland Density of Computed Tomography Scanners in Ambulatory Sector jumped by 2.8% year on year. With 14.01 Units Per Million Persons in 2019, the country was ranked number 6 among other countries in Density of Computed Tomography Scanners in Ambulatory Sector. Iceland is overtaken by Switzerland, which was ranked number 5 with 14.69 Units Per Million Persons and is followed by Austria with 11.16 Units Per Million Persons. Greece ranked the highest with 24.31 Units Per Million Persons in 2019, that is a decrease of 3.7% compared to 2018. Latvia, United States and Germany resp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. France witnessed the best average annual growth at +19.7% per year, while Israel witnessed the worst performance at -2.9% per year.
